Insurance

There are many advantages to car key replacement services. Most car dealerships have an inventory of metal blank keys and can cut keys for you. In rare instances they'll need to order the keys from a supplier which can take some time. If you have a transponder key it could be necessary to purchase a replacement, which could cost you more than $320. You'll have to pay for towing and replacement costs. It is also possible to consider car key replacement services which include assistance with roadside emergencies or lockouts.

The majority of auto insurance policies cover locksmiths, even locksmiths who cut keys. According to your policy, this may be part of the Roadside Assistance coverage, which covers car lockout services. Some insurers limit the number of locksmith services that are able to be covered per year and per case. Before you call a locksmith, it's important to know the details of the terms of your insurance policy. Certain firms will cover these expenses in the event that you have collision and comprehensive coverage, while other companies may not.
